Venezuela - Roots and Tubers Harvested Area
Since 2014, Venezuela Roots and Tubers Harvested Area was up 0.6%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 69 comparing other countries in Roots and Tubers Harvested Area with 76,888 Hectares. Venezuela is overtaken by Kyrgyzstan, which was number 68 at 79,208 Hectares and is followed by Liberia at 73,453 Hectares. Nigeria ranked the highest with 16,500,407 Hectares in 2019, an increase of 5.5% versus 2018. China, Democratic Republic of the Congo and India resp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Grenada recorded the best 5 years average growth at +31.1% per year, while Latvia was the worst growing country at -17.9% per year.
